In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:

f2fs: fix to truncate meta inode pages forcely

Below race case can cause data corruption:

Thread A GC thread
- gc_data_segment
- ra_data_block
- locked meta_inode page
- f2fs_inplace_write_data
- invalidate_mapping_pages
: fail to invalidate meta_inode page
due to lock failure or dirty|writeback
status
- f2fs_submit_page_bio
: write last dirty data to old blkaddr
- move_data_block
- load old data from meta_inode page
- f2fs_submit_page_write
: write old data to new blkaddr

Because invalidate_mapping_pages() will skip invalidating page which
has unclear status including locked, dirty, writeback and so on, so
we need to use truncate_inode_pages_range() instead of
invalidate_mapping_pages() to make sure meta_inode page will be dropped.
